Dépannage du SDK Azure Messaging
Référence rapide
| Propriété |
Valeur |
| Services |
Azure Event Hubs, Azure Service Bus |
| Outils MCP |
mcp_azure_mcp_eventhubs, mcp_azure_mcp_servicebus |
| Idéal pour |
Diagnostiquer les problèmes de connexion, d'authentification et de traitement des messages du SDK |
Quand utiliser cette skill
- Échecs de connexion SDK, erreurs d'authentification ou erreurs de lien AMQP
- Timeout d'inactivité, inactivité de connexion ou reconnexion lente après déconnexion
- Erreurs de détachement de lien AMQP ou de détachement forcé
- Verrou de message perdu, verrou de message expiré, échecs de renouvellement de verrou ou timeouts de verrou par lot
- Verrou de session perdu, verrou de session expiré ou erreurs de récepteur de session
- Le processeur d'événements ou le gestionnaire de messages arrête le traitement
- Événements en doublon ou réinitialisations d'offset de point de contrôle
- Questions sur la configuration du SDK (retry, prefetch, taille du lot, comportement de réception par lot)
Outils MCP
| Outil |
Commande |
Utilisation |
mcp_azure_mcp_eventhubs |
Ops namespace/hub |
Lister les namespaces, hubs, groupes de consommateurs |
mcp_azure_mcp_servicebus |
Ops queue/topic |
Lister les namespaces, queues, topics, souscriptions |
mcp_azure_mcp_monitor |
logs_query |
Interroger les journaux de diagnostic avec KQL |
mcp_azure_mcp_resourcehealth |
get |
Vérifier l'état de santé du service |
mcp_azure_mcp_documentation |
Doc search |
Rechercher sur Microsoft Learn la documentation de dépannage |
Flux de diagnostic
- Identifier le SDK et la version — Vérifier les indices de SDK et de version dans l'invite ; si non fournis, procéder au diagnostic et demander ultérieurement si nécessaire
- Vérifier la santé des ressources — Utiliser
mcp_azure_mcp_resourcehealth pour vérifier que le namespace est sain
- Examiner le message d'erreur — Matcher par rapport au guide de dépannage spécifique à la langue
- Consulter la documentation — Utiliser
mcp_azure_mcp_documentation pour rechercher sur Microsoft Learn l'erreur ou le sujet
- Vérifier la configuration — Vérifier la chaîne de connexion, le nom de l'entité, le groupe de consommateurs
- Recommander un correctif — Appliquer la correction, en citant la documentation trouvée
Guides de dépannage
Les guides de dépannage de connectivité, SDK et authentification se trouvent dans la skill azure-diagnostics sous troubleshooting/messaging/.
Références
- Utiliser
mcp_azure_mcp_documentation pour rechercher sur Microsoft Learn les derniers conseils.